Acetic Acid Water 0.01M ?? Sterile Peptide Reconstitution Solution
Introduction
Acetic Acid Water (0.01M) is a sterile, pH-adjusted aqueous solution specifically formulated for the reconstitution and stabilization of pH-sensitive research peptides. Many peptide sequences, particularly those containing basic amino acid residues or those prone to aggregation in neutral pH environments, require a mildly acidic solvent to achieve complete dissolution and maintain structural integrity. This dilute acetic acid solution serves as the preferred reconstitution medium for specialized peptides including MGF, PEG-MGF, and various growth factor analogs that exhibit poor solubility in sterile water alone.

Applications in Peptide Research
Acetic Acid Water is routinely utilized in the following research applications:
- Reconstitution of pH-Sensitive Peptides: Certain peptides, such as MGF and PEG-MGF, require an acidic environment (pH 4.0?C5.0) for optimal solubility and to prevent aggregation during reconstitution.
- Stabilization of Peptide Secondary Structure: The mild acidic conditions help maintain the native conformation of acid-stable peptides, preserving biological activity during storage and handling.
- Preparation of Stock Solutions: Researchers use this solution to create concentrated peptide stock solutions for subsequent dilution into experimental buffers or carrier solutions.
Usage Guidelines
For optimal results, reconstitute lyophilized peptide powder by injecting 1mL to 2mL of Acetic Acid Water directly into the vial. Gently swirl until the peptide is fully dissolved. For most applications, the reconstituted solution can be further diluted with Bacteriostatic Water or phosphate-buffered saline to achieve the desired working concentration. Once reconstituted, the peptide solution should be stored at 2?C8??C and used within 7?C14 days for maximum stability.

FAQ
Why use Acetic Acid Water instead of Bacteriostatic Water?
Certain peptides, particularly growth factor analogs with isoelectric points above 7.0, require an acidic pH to fully dissolve. Acetic Acid Water provides the necessary acidic environment that Bacteriostatic Water (pH 5.5?C6.5) cannot achieve.
What peptides require Acetic Acid Water for reconstitution?
MGF, PEG-MGF, and various IGF-1 analogs are commonly cited in research literature as requiring dilute acetic acid for complete dissolution. Always consult the specific peptide’s technical data sheet.
How should I store reconstituted peptide solutions?
Once reconstituted in Acetic Acid Water, peptide solutions should be refrigerated at 2?C8??C and used within 7?C14 days to maintain stability.
Can I use this solution for all peptides?
No, some peptides are acid-labile and may degrade in low pH environments. Always verify peptide stability in acidic conditions before using this solution.
